US court rules Meta, other tech firms must face thousands of lawsuits over social media addiction

A U.S. appeals court on Monday allowed thousands of lawsuits to move forward against Meta Platforms, Alphabet’s Google, ByteDance’s TikTok and Snap Inc’s Snapchat over claims they designed their products to be addictive to young users.

The San Francisco-based 9th U.S. Circuit ​Court of Appeals rejected an appeal by Meta and TikTok seeking to overturn a lower court ruling requiring them to face more than 3,000 lawsuits filed in federal court, saying the companies had appealed too early.
